Before installing LiGo's Chrome extension, make sure your setup is compatible.
What Works
Browsers That Work
- Google Chrome (recommended)
- Microsoft Edge
That's it. Only these two browsers are supported.
Devices That Work
- Desktop computers (Windows, Mac, Linux)
That's it. Only desktop computers are supported.
What Doesn't Work
Browsers That DON'T Work
- Firefox
- Safari
- Opera
- Brave
- Any mobile browser
- Any tablet browser
Why? LiGo uses Chrome-specific extension technology that doesn't exist in other browsers. Supporting other browsers would require rebuilding the entire extension from scratch.
Devices That DON'T Work
- Mobile phones - Chrome extensions cannot run on mobile browsers (this is a browser limitation, not a LiGo limitation)
- Tablets - Same issue as phones, including iPads
- Chromebooks - Might work but we don't officially test or support them

Common Questions
"Why not support Firefox?"
Different browsers use different extension systems. Supporting Firefox would mean rebuilding everything from scratch, essentially creating two separate products.
"Can I use this on my iPad?"
No. Chrome extensions don't work on any mobile or tablet device, including iPads, Android tablets, or any other mobile platform.
"What about Chromebooks?"
Chromebooks run Chrome OS and might work, but we don't officially test or support them. If you encounter issues on a Chromebook, we might not be able to provide technical support.
"Will you support mobile in the future?"
Chrome extensions fundamentally cannot work on mobile devices due to browser architecture limitations. We'd need to build a completely different mobile app, which isn't currently in our roadmap.

Technical Details
Why Only Chrome and Edge?
- Both browsers use the Chromium engine
- They support the Chrome Extension API that LiGo requires
- Edge has built-in Chrome extension compatibility
- Other browsers use different extension architectures
What LiGo Needs to Function
- Access to LinkedIn.com
- Permission to run scripts on LinkedIn
- Ability to communicate with LiGo's servers
- Local storage for authentication tokens
